Use the appropriate Database



Choosing the ideal databases is actually a essential A part of building scalable purposes. Not all databases are developed exactly the same, and utilizing the Mistaken one can gradual you down and even trigger failures as your app grows.

Get started by comprehension your information. Can it be very structured, like rows in a desk? If Sure, a relational databases like PostgreSQL or MySQL is an effective in good shape. These are solid with relationships, transactions, and regularity. They also guidance scaling tactics like read replicas, indexing, and partitioning to manage much more website traffic and information.

In case your facts is more versatile—like person action logs, products catalogs, or documents—take into consideration a NoSQL alternative like MongoDB, Cassandra, or DynamoDB. NoSQL databases are improved at dealing with big volumes of unstructured or semi-structured facts and can scale horizontally far more easily.

Also, take into account your read and compose styles. Are you currently executing lots of reads with much less writes? Use caching and read replicas. Do you think you're managing a heavy compose load? Check into databases that can manage superior create throughput, as well as event-primarily based knowledge storage units like Apache Kafka (for temporary information streams).

It’s also good to Imagine ahead. You may not need to have Highly developed scaling attributes now, but selecting a database that supports them signifies you gained’t will need to modify afterwards.

Use indexing to hurry up queries. Avoid pointless joins. Normalize or denormalize your info dependant upon your entry designs. And constantly watch databases general performance when you mature.

To put it briefly, the ideal databases relies on your application’s framework, pace wants, And the way you count on it to expand. Consider time to pick wisely—it’ll save loads of hassle afterwards.

Improve Code and Queries



Speedy code is essential to scalability. As your app grows, each and every little hold off provides up. Inadequately composed code or unoptimized queries can slow down performance and overload your system. That’s why it’s crucial to Develop efficient logic from the beginning.

Start off by creating clean, very simple code. Prevent repeating logic and remove something avoidable. Don’t select the most sophisticated Remedy if a simple a person performs. Keep your capabilities limited, focused, and straightforward to test. Use profiling applications to seek out bottlenecks—locations where by your code takes far too extended to operate or employs an excessive amount of memory.

Future, examine your databases queries. These usually gradual factors down more than the code by itself. Be sure Every question only asks for the data you really need. Steer clear of Pick out *, which fetches every thing, and in its place choose precise fields. Use indexes to speed up lookups. And keep away from carrying out a lot of joins, especially across substantial tables.

In the event you observe the same info remaining requested over and over, use caching. Retail outlet the results briefly using resources like Redis or Memcached therefore you don’t have to repeat pricey functions.

Also, batch your databases functions when you can. As opposed to updating a row one after the other, update them in teams. This cuts down on overhead and will make your application much more successful.

Make sure to test with big datasets. Code and queries that operate high-quality with a hundred documents might crash once they have to deal with 1 million.

In a nutshell, scalable applications are rapid apps. Keep your code tight, your queries lean, and use caching when required. These measures support your application stay smooth and responsive, even as the load raises.

Leverage Load Balancing and Caching



As your app grows, it has to handle much more people plus much more targeted visitors. If everything goes through one server, it will quickly turn into a bottleneck. That’s where by load balancing and caching are available. Both of these instruments support maintain your app rapidly, steady, and scalable.

Load balancing spreads incoming visitors across multiple servers. In lieu of a person server executing the many operate, the load balancer routes consumers to various servers according to availability. This suggests no one server will get overloaded. If one particular server goes down, the load balancer can ship traffic to the Many others. Instruments like Nginx, HAProxy, or cloud-based mostly options from AWS and Google Cloud make this easy to build.

Caching is about storing knowledge temporarily so it might be reused speedily. When customers ask for precisely the same details once again—like a product site or even a profile—you don’t have to fetch it within the database when. It is possible to serve it with the cache.

There are 2 common sorts of caching:

1. Server-facet caching (like Redis or Memcached) retailers info in memory for fast entry.

two. Consumer-side caching (like browser caching or CDN caching) stores static documents close to the person.

Caching minimizes databases load, improves pace, and makes your application more efficient.

Use caching for things that don’t improve usually. And normally make certain your cache is up-to-date when data does adjust.

In short, load balancing and caching are straightforward but impressive resources. Jointly, they assist your app take care of extra people, stay rapidly, and Get better from issues. If you intend to mature, you'll need equally.



Use Cloud and Container Applications



To build scalable programs, you need equipment that permit your app develop simply. That’s exactly where cloud platforms and containers are available in. They provide you adaptability, reduce setup time, and make scaling A lot smoother.

Cloud platforms like Amazon World wide web Expert services (AWS), Google Cloud System (GCP), and Microsoft Azure Permit you to rent servers and solutions as you will need them. You don’t really need to obtain components or guess upcoming potential. When site visitors boosts, you could increase more resources with just a few clicks or automatically utilizing automobile-scaling. When targeted traffic drops, you may scale down to save cash.

These platforms also offer you expert services like managed databases, storage, load balancing, and stability instruments. You may center on building your application instead of managing infrastructure.

Containers are A further vital Software. A container offers your application and almost everything it has to run—code, libraries, configurations—into just one device. This makes it easy to maneuver your application in between environments, from the laptop towards the cloud, without surprises. Docker is the preferred Resource for this.

Whenever your app works by using a number of containers, resources like Kubernetes help you regulate them. Kubernetes handles deployment, scaling, and recovery. If one section of the app crashes, it restarts it quickly.

Containers also ensure it is easy to separate aspects of your app into solutions. You can update or scale pieces independently, and that is perfect for efficiency and reliability.

In a nutshell, utilizing cloud and container instruments implies you could scale rapidly, deploy easily, and Recuperate quickly when troubles occur. In order for you your app to mature without having restrictions, commence working with these resources early. They help save time, reduce chance, and assist you remain centered on setting up, not fixing.

Keep an eye on All the things



Should you don’t keep an eye on your software, you won’t know when items go Erroneous. Monitoring will help the thing is how your application is performing, spot troubles check here early, and make improved decisions as your app grows. It’s a crucial Section of setting up scalable systems.

Commence by tracking standard metrics like CPU use, memory, disk House, and reaction time. These tell you how your servers and solutions are carrying out. Equipment like Prometheus, Grafana, Datadog, or New Relic may help you gather and visualize this info.

Don’t just keep an eye on your servers—watch your application much too. Regulate how much time it takes for customers to load webpages, how often mistakes take place, and in which they take place. Logging equipment like ELK Stack (Elasticsearch, Logstash, Kibana) or Loggly can assist you see what’s occurring inside your code.

Create alerts for crucial difficulties. As an example, Should your reaction time goes earlier mentioned a limit or even a support goes down, you ought to get notified instantly. This assists you take care of challenges rapid, generally ahead of consumers even discover.

Monitoring is usually handy if you make adjustments. In the event you deploy a new aspect and find out a spike in mistakes or slowdowns, you can roll it again ahead of it will cause actual harm.

As your application grows, targeted traffic and information maximize. Devoid of monitoring, you’ll pass up signs of trouble right until it’s way too late. But with the proper instruments in place, you continue to be in control.

To put it briefly, checking assists you keep the app responsible and scalable. It’s not nearly recognizing failures—it’s about knowing your system and making certain it works perfectly, even under pressure.
